码迷,mamicode.com
首页 >  
搜索关键字:drawrect    ( 392个结果
使用UIBezierPath绘制图形
当需要画图时我们一般创建一个UIView子类, 重写其中的drawRect方法 再drawRect方法中利用UIBezierPath添加画图 UIBezierPath的使用方法: (1)创建一个Bezier path对象。 (2)使用方法moveToPoint:去设置初始线段的起点。 (3)添加li ...
分类:其他好文   时间:2017-01-05 18:16:41    阅读次数:236
drawRect与setNeedsDisplay简单介绍
1.rect默认就是自己的bounds 2.drawRect的调用? // - 当视图第一次显示到屏幕的时候会调用一次 // - 在调用这个方法的时候,系统会帮我们创建好图形上下文,所以我们只需要获取图形上下文即可 // - 显示完毕之后,就不会再调用此方法 3.如何调用drawRect方法 // ...
分类:其他好文   时间:2017-01-05 16:50:33    阅读次数:186
贝赛尔曲线UIBezierPath(后续)
使用CAShapeLayer与UIBezierPath可以实现不在view的drawRect方法中就画出一些想要的图形 。 1:UIBezierPath: UIBezierPath是在 UIKit 中的一个类,继承于NSObject,可以创建基于矢量的路径.此类是Core Graphics框架关于p ...
分类:其他好文   时间:2017-01-03 20:25:41    阅读次数:211
IOS--PDF显示(CGPDFDocumentRef)
摘要: 学习使用自定义view加载显示pdf; 前言 在IOS中预览pdf文件,显示pdf文件一般使用两种方式,一种是UIWebView,这种方式怎么说呢优点就是除了简单还是简单,直接显示pdf文件;另外的一种是自定义UIView,配合CGPDFDocumentRef读取pdf文件里面的内容,在自定 ...
分类:移动开发   时间:2016-12-19 11:30:27    阅读次数:212
验证码
using System; using System.Collections.Generic; using System.Drawing; using System.Drawing.Drawing2D; using System.Drawing.Imaging; using System.IO; u ...
分类:其他好文   时间:2016-12-10 18:37:40    阅读次数:216
从Android绘制View小例子中深入理解自定义View
平时开发界面时,Android系统为我们提供了各种各样的View组件,TextView、ImageView、Button、LinearLayout、ScrollView、ListView等等,这些也基...
分类:移动开发   时间:2016-12-10 11:24:55    阅读次数:246
canvas实践1
今天帮同学遇到问题,我于是就利用了canvas帮他写了个效果,效果如图 我本来在学习不是很想做,但是昨天感觉自己学的有点累就去帮忙做了,我的思路是每次画一个矩形,然后通过rotate旋转让它自身旋转45度,旋转完再用translate位移到目标点,先定义一个正方形的类,然后实例了很多个正方形,之后用 ...
分类:其他好文   时间:2016-12-01 09:50:45    阅读次数:193
iOS实现类似于歌词进度效果
先看效果 这里关键的地方在于镂空文字的实现,可以用UILabel的drawRect方法。 .h文件 .m文件 重要的是drawRect的实现 实现镂空文字后,再在HollowLabel下贴图,一层背景view,一层变色view,用NSTimer改变【变色view】的宽度就可以实现歌词效果。 ...
分类:移动开发   时间:2016-11-24 14:13:44    阅读次数:297
iOS学习笔记08-Quartz2D绘图
一、Quartz2D简单介绍 在iOS中常用的绘图框架就是Quartz2D,Quartz2D是Core Graphics框架的一部分,我们日常开发使用的所有UIKit组件都是由Core Graphics进行绘制的 UIKit默认为我们提供了一个图形上下文,在UI控件的drawRect:方法中调用UI ...
分类:移动开发   时间:2016-11-15 11:13:33    阅读次数:258
iOS中图片水印的制作
// .获取上下文,之前的上下文都是在view的drawRect方法中获取(跟View相关联的上下文layer上下文) // 目前我们需要绘制图片到新的图片上,因此需要用到位图上下文 // 怎么获取位图上下文,注意位图上下文的获取方式跟layer上下文不一样。位图上下文需要我们手动创建。 // 开启 ...
分类:移动开发   时间:2016-11-04 20:47:18    阅读次数:179
392条   上一页 1 ... 6 7 8 9 10 ... 40 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!